An alternative to feed
Looking at the possibility of using alternative feeds is vital for beef and sheep producers, especially during this period of rising feed costs.
This is one of the subjects that will be covered at the English Beef and Lamb Executives (EBLEX) open meeting being held for beef and sheep levy payers at Skipton Livestock Market from 6 pm to 9.15pm on Monday, November 26.
The meeting will also give producers an opportunity to see a virtual beef and lamb selection demonstration. This is a new interactive computer based programme that has been developed by EBLEX as part of their Better Returns Programmes to enable farmers to see at the touch of a button the appearance of different fat levels and conformation classes on an animal.
A marketing and butchery session will focus on some of the promotional activity that has been rolled out in the wake of the current difficulties, and give a demonstration of seam butchery techniques, which form part of ongoing EBLEX development activity on premium beef and lamb cuts.
